这是结构
<a-tree
class="device-tree-node"
showIcon
:expandedKeys="expandedKeys"
:autoExpandParent="autoExpandParent"
:treeData="treeData"
@expand="onExpand"
:selectedKeys="selectedKeys"
:multiple="isMultiple"
@select="onTreeSelect"
:style="{ width: deviceTreeWidth }"
@rightClick="test($event)"
>
<span class="line" v-if="item.lineIcon && showLineIcon" @click.stop>
<img src="@/assets/device-tree/line2.png" @click="vShowLine" alt="" />
<img src="@/assets/device-tree/line1.png" @click="beginPatrol" alt="" />
}
.ant-select-selection__rendered {
line-height: 20px !important;
margin-right: 0;
margin-left: 8px;
}
首先class有没有生效,如果有class那么应该是样式被覆盖了。
如果class都没有,那试试把/deep/ 换成 v-deep或者>>>试试